Good Morning. The appetite for gambling within the Asia-Pacific region is not going away. A recent study opines that the CAGR could grow in excess of 6 percent in the next five years, as desire for both land-based and online gaming continue to increase. Meanwhile, Thailand's potential gaming framework is going through the rounds, with a possible 5 percent limit on casino spaces in IRs. And in Macau, recent visa policies announced by China are set to have a strong impact, even as other jurisdictions miss out.
